Move project panel middleware to store directory
authorMichal Klobukowski <michal.klobukowski@contractors.roche.com>
Thu, 5 Jul 2018 14:12:48 +0000 (16:12 +0200)
committerMichal Klobukowski <michal.klobukowski@contractors.roche.com>
Thu, 5 Jul 2018 14:12:48 +0000 (16:12 +0200)
Feature #13703

Arvados-DCO-1.1-Signed-off-by: Michal Klobukowski <michal.klobukowski@contractors.roche.com>

src/store/project-panel/project-panel-middleware.ts [moved from src/views/project-panel/project-panel-middleware.ts with 97% similarity]
src/store/store.ts

similarity index 97%
rename from src/views/project-panel/project-panel-middleware.ts
rename to src/store/project-panel/project-panel-middleware.ts
index 0e1e764bb8adf8c4645fe6d9ab83151df10086a8..e72b6c1b905469e9a5f6ea5e2d9bbc7457b0de23 100644 (file)
@@ -4,11 +4,11 @@
 
 import { Middleware } from "redux";
 import actions from "../../store/data-explorer/data-explorer-action";
-import { PROJECT_PANEL_ID, columns, ProjectPanelFilter, ProjectPanelColumnNames } from "./project-panel";
+import { PROJECT_PANEL_ID, columns, ProjectPanelFilter, ProjectPanelColumnNames } from "../../views/project-panel/project-panel";
 import { groupsService } from "../../services/services";
 import { RootState } from "../../store/store";
 import { getDataExplorer, DataExplorerState } from "../../store/data-explorer/data-explorer-reducer";
-import { resourceToDataItem, ProjectPanelItem } from "./project-panel-item";
+import { resourceToDataItem, ProjectPanelItem } from "../../views/project-panel/project-panel-item";
 import FilterBuilder from "../../common/api/filter-builder";
 import { DataColumns } from "../../components/data-table/data-table";
 import { ProcessResource } from "../../models/process";
index 0c32e6538621dfdc0106173e025fd19bff700675..00c2ad75e422b074e53ab7cba5f90742c8a781be 100644 (file)
@@ -12,7 +12,7 @@ import sidePanelReducer, { SidePanelState } from './side-panel/side-panel-reduce
 import authReducer, { AuthState } from "./auth/auth-reducer";
 import dataExplorerReducer, { DataExplorerState } from './data-explorer/data-explorer-reducer';
 import collectionsReducer, { CollectionState } from "./collection/collection-reducer";
-import { projectPanelMiddleware } from '../views/project-panel/project-panel-middleware';
+import { projectPanelMiddleware } from '../store/project-panel/project-panel-middleware';
 
 const composeEnhancers =
     (process.env.NODE_ENV === 'development' &&